Approach WS in Singapore
|
Instructor(s) for Coaching: |
Sebastian Drake
|
|
The Good |
I took the Bootcamp in December 2007 with Sebastian Drake and Asian Rake.
It consisted of 3 afternoons of informal lectures, feedback and exercises and two nights in the field.
Sebastian is a great teacher with a natural talent for spotting what students to need. Asian Rake was good too.
Compared to other bootcamps there is a huge amount of personal attention.
There was also a very high instructor to student ratio (2:3).
The content seemed innovative and different to a lot of other stuff in the community, but is actually quite similar to the Approach Ebook, so if you have read that it might not be so new.
Very good fashion advice.
You get access to the Approach alumni forum, which is absolutely excellent. Great advice, no flame wars, close to 100% on topic.
There is a structured series of exercises to follow for 10 weeks after the Bootcamp, so you aren't stuck thinking 'what next?'
|
|
The Bad |
Sebastian didn't spend much time with us on the second night, as he was tired from the night before. The 20 minutes we winged each other on the first night was golden - he gave me so much great advice afterwards. But I was left thinking how much more could have been achieved if he had put more effort in on the second night.
|
|
Would You Recommend It? |
Yes

Badboy WS with Cortez in Zagreb
|
Instructor(s) for Coaching: |
Cortez
|
|
The Good |
I took the workshop with Cortez back in 2005. Cortez took me and two other students; Badboy ran a parallel workshop with three other students the same weekend and we met up on some of the nights.
It had the most field time of any workshop I have taken. Thurs, Fri and Sat nights in bars/clubs and day game on Thurs, Fri, and Sat afternoon.
Absolutely great for pushing you to approach and break fears/limiting beliefs.
Totally changed my mindset, they use a lot of NLP to get you into state and change you beliefs. For me the effect lasted for 3-4 weeks after the bootcamp.
They teach a very simple system of getting the attention of girls and attraction through boldness, confidence and dominance.
A lot of verbal fluency exercises, which are now common in the industry, but were pioneered by Badboy, help you get into state.
|
|
The Bad |
They tell you stay away from forums and from all other seduction workshops/methods. This can leave you a bit unsupported after the workshop.
Their alumni forum is (or was) pretty dead.
Because they do very bold direct approaches, its easy to chicken out of doing them after the workshop and fall back into habits of not approaching.
Cortez was a much better teacher than Badboy.
When I took the WS it was great value for money - perhaps 1200$, no prices have risen so much it is quite expensive.
|
|
Would You Recommend It? |
Yes

Mystery Method WS in Stockholm
|
Instructor(s) for Coaching: |
Sheriff • The Don
|
|
The Good |
I took the bootcamp in Summer 06 in Stockholm.
Great customer service - information sheets, emails before course etc.
My results did pick up after the bootcamp - surprisingly I became more direct and got more kiss closes. One or two of the guys had a lot of success after the bootcamp.
Sheriff and Sinn are good instructors. Good at giving feedback, good at pushing people into sets and fun to work with.
The demonstrations, while not great, did teach me that all game does not have to be flash game or super rapid escalation. The girls were into them for sure.
|
|
The Bad |
Far too many students (14+ in field). With that many it doesn't matter what the instructor to student ratio is, its too chaotic and you will always get relatively poor service and little personal attention. We had a ratio of about 1:3 or 1:4, but it might as well have been 1:6.
It may have changed now, bu WS I took was heavily routine based. I was living in Spain at the time, so not very practical as was hard to translate all the routines into Spanish.
Some of the instructors seemed to be spending most the time sarging for themselves. One cock blocked a student. Others tried, but were unable to give advice beyond 'well done you spoke to her for five minutes!'. I would not recommend LondonPlayboy, The Don or Max; although others did have better things to say about them.
Incredibly expensive. Almost twice some other better workshops. You pay a lot for the brand name.
|
|
Would You Recommend It? |
No

The Social Man bootcamp NY city
|
Instructor(s) for Coaching: |
Christian Hudson • Nick Sparks
|
|
The Good |
Took a 4 day WS as part of 'Unbreakable' 10 week program in Oct 08.
3 days lectures/excercises; 1 afternoon of day game, 3 evenings in field and round up/feedback on last morning.
Very good instructors, dedicated to helping their clients and excellent value for money. No idea why their WS are so cheap. Nick Sparks brings a load of energy and Christian Hudson is great at diagnosing student's problems.
Huge amount of personal attention, even more than the Approach. They tailor the syllabus to the individual student.
Got to hang out in Christian Hudson's cool NY apartment and got invited to some of his parties.
They took us to some really great venues with lots of girls, high through flow of new people, not too loud and no other bootcamps.
I kiss closed a girl 6 inches taller than me on the last evening. One guy got laid twice over the weekend workshop.
Absolutely THE choice if you live in or around NY city.
2:1 instructor to student ratio. But in practice better because some very advanced ex-students joined for two nights. I spent about 2 hours 1-1 with Christian Hudson on the last night.
|
|
The Bad |
Follow up after the bootcamp is slim, but that is true for most seduction companies. They are working on it.
Probably better instructors out there for street game. Although they did get everyone approaching which is an achievement.
|
|
Would You Recommend It? |
Yes

Fidentia (Attract and Date) in Prague
|
The Good |
I took a Fidentia WS in Prague in Autumn 05. Instructors Cameron Teone, Robert, and Ranko. Fidentia is long gone, so I'll just focus on Ranko as he was clearly the core behind the company and had the best game.
Ranko is the BEST instructor for street game I have ever met. Absolutely the real deal. Very few other instructors are good at this.
Very good at teaching direct game (night and day) and day game.
I learnt how to take a girl on an instant-date on the WS and was first of many since. So it was instrumental to my development as a PUA.
|
|
The Bad |
not much follow up
the direct-method forum is full of KJs and people spouting bad advice. (not sure if it is affiliated any longer).
Ranko's focus on direct and beating 'excuses' is good in that it helps break limiting beliefs and you can get great reactions from girls. However, it is limiting and can stunt your development in other ways if you don't experiment with other things also.
Direct street approaches can lead to a lot of flakes for some people and this is especially the case if you haven't got the rest of your life/game together and have only learnt to approach confidently.
|
|
Would You Recommend It? |
Yes
